
Revolutionizing Supply Chain Automation
Symbotic stands as a global leader in integrated supply network automation, transforming how the world's largest retailers, wholesalers, and food & beverage companies move goods through their distribution networks. Founded in 2007 and headquartered in Wilmington, Massachusetts, this publicly-traded innovator (NYSE: SYM) employs 1,000-5,000 professionals across seven strategic locations in the United States and Canada, generating $1-5 billion in annual revenue.
AI Powered Technology Platform
Symbotic's proprietary robotics and software solutions orchestrate end-to-end warehouse automation, enabling companies to handle millions of cases daily with unmatched speed, accuracy, and efficiency. The company's intelligent platform combines high-density storage, machine learning, and advanced robotic systems to solve today's most complex distribution challenges-reducing costs from manufacturer to store shelf while enabling customers to scale operations flexibly.

Senior Internal Technology Auditor
Description
Who we are
With its A.I.-powered robotic technology platform, Symbotic is changing the way consumer goods move through the supply chain. Intelligent software orchestrates advanced robots in a high-density, end-to-end system - reinventing warehouse automation for increased efficiency, speed and flexibility.
What we need
As a Senior Internal Technology (IT) Auditor you will help build and strengthen our Internal Audit function as we continue to scale. In this role, you will play a critical part in developing and executing our SOX and IT security compliance program. You will ensure effective internal controls and provide insights that add value to the organization. This is a hands-on position in a fast-growing, dynamic environment, ideal for a professional looking to make a meaningful impact on innovative technology company. This role reports to the Senior Manager, Internal Audit -Business Process & IT.
What we do
The Internal Audit team is a part of the Symbotic Finance team. They bring a systematic and disciplined approach to evaluate and improve the effectiveness of Symbotic's risk management, internal controls, and governance processes supporting such controls.
What you'll do
- Plan and execute control design and operating effectiveness testing for SOX IT general controls, SDLC assessments and SOC report reviews across key applications, including documenting controls, performing walkthroughs and assessing design and operating effectiveness testing.
- Perform SOX testing of key reports and application controls, including configuration, security, and automated controls within SAP and other business systems.
- Work with analytical and automation tools to conduct efficient audit testing.
- Test controls assigned within cyber audits, including evaluating controls against cyber frameworks, such as NIST CSF and COBIT.
- Test IT general controls and application controls in SAP ERP environment
- Perform root cause analysis for control deficiencies and provide actionable recommendations to management for SOX and cybersecurity audits.
- Facilitate awareness and training for stakeholders on internal controls, SOX compliance, and risk management practices.
- Build strong relationships across IT security, HRIS and SAP teams, promoting the Internal Audit function through high-quality audit work and effective communication.
What you'll need
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, IT, management, or related field.
- CISA or equivalent certification required.
- Minimum 3 years of internal audit or external audit experience, preferably with a Big 4 firm or publicly traded company
- Effective project management, organizational, and communication skills (verbal and written).
- IT application controls and key reports testing experience.
- Experience collaborating with management and key stakeholders, with the ability to build strong professional relationships across business units and the audit team.
- Experience with GRC platforms (preferably Workiva).
